My husband and I are heavy set and I'm wondering about being too big to enjoy things like the River Canyon Run. Are there weight restrictions?
Connie, There are some weight restrictions on some rides. The restrictions on River Canyon Run is two, three, four, or five riders per tube are permitted with a combined weight not to exceed 800 lbs. The Alberta Fall restrictions are 250 lbs. max in a single tube and 400 lbs. max in a double tube. What are the height restrictions for the water park?
Karen, There are height requirements and restrictions for certain attractions. Alberta Falls tube slide attraction requires a rider to be at least 42 inches and anyone between 42-48 inches must be accompanied by and adult. The Caribou Creek Lazy River requirements are that you anyone under 42 inches must be accompanied by an adult. The Whooping Hollow slides are for smaller guest and the height limit on those is 48 inches and under. Fort Mackenzie™
We've turned splashing into an adventure at Fort Mackenzie, our 4-story interactive tree house in the center of our 84 degree indoor water park. Adventure through suspension bridges, swinging cargo nets, treetop slides and soaking spray stations. If that doesn't get you drenched, just wait for our 1,000-gallon bucket to tip from the treetops.
Alberta Falls™
Alberta Falls is four stories of fun. Twist in and out of the Lodge before dropping into the plunge pool. (Don't worry, the tube is enclosed so there's no temperature change!)

Soak'n Oak Springs™
They can safely toddle along, exploring the playtime kiddie tree, or wade into the zero-depth entry kiddie pool with a maximum depth of 1' 6".

Raccoon Lagoon™
Raccoon Lagoon Outdoor Pool area ranges from zero-depth entry to four feet and includes water basketball, kiddie activities, floor geysers and spray features, as well as heated water. There is a patio area with tables and chairs so you can relax in the sun. Typically open Memorial Day weekend to Labor Day weekend, weather permitting. Hours vary.
